Product Description

The 80/20 Standard Anchor Fastener Assembly (MPN 13186) is a zinc anchor connector designed for slide-in mounting in 30 Series T-slots with an 8 9/64 mm slot width. This unfinished component provides a secure fastening point for framing structures.

What is the 80/20 Standard Anchor Fastener Assembly used for?

The 80/20 Standard Anchor Fastener Assembly (MPN 13186) is used to create secure fastening points in 30 Series T-slot aluminum framing. It is ideal for industrial workstations, machine guards, and modular structures where a slide-in zinc anchor connector provides reliable load transfer.

What are the specifications of the 80/20 Standard Anchor Fastener Assembly?

This anchor connector is made of zinc with an unfinished finish. It is designed for slide-in mounting in 30 Series T-slots with an 8 9/64 mm slot width. The manufacturer part number is 13186, and it is produced by 80/20.

How to install the 80/20 Standard Anchor Fastener Assembly?

To install, slide the zinc anchor connector into the T-slot of 30 Series framing at the desired position. Tighten the fastener to secure it against the slot walls. Ensure the slot width matches 8 9/64 mm for proper fit. Follow standard T-slot framing best practices for load distribution.
